Abstract

Liquid crystals containing “open” analogues of the mesomorphic amide 1,4,7‐triazacyclononane, i.e., 3,4‐bis(alkoxy)‐ benzoyl substituted diethylenetriamine, are reported, showing that the closed‐ring structure of the central core is not essential for mesomorphism in these compounds.
